What Are Pointed Toe Heels?

Pointed toe heels are characterized by their elongated, narrow toe shape tapering sharply to a fine point or slight curve. Designed to elongate the foot, the pointed toe slims the line of the ankle and foot, creating a sleek silhouette that complements both slim and medium-length legs. Typically found in Pumps, stilettos, and even some sandals, pointed toes exude confidence and classic beauty.

While pointed toe heels look striking, comfort is essential for all-day wear. Here are key tips for selecting the best pair:

  • Wide Across the Toe: Look for shoes with adequate toe box room to prevent crowding and pressure. Avoid overly narrow points on narrower shapes.
  • Strap Support: Opt for velcro, lace-up, or buckle styles for improved stability and a secure fit.
  • Flex Design: Flexible soles reduce strain on ankles and encourage natural movement.
  • Heel Height: Balance height with security—block heels offer stability, while stilettos define sharpness. Limit height (2.5–4 inches) for all-day comfort.

Care and Maintenance Tips

Preserving the elegance of your pointed toe heels extends their lifespan and appearance:

  • Clean Promptly: Wipe off dirt after wearing; deep clean biannually.
  • Avoid Wet Surfaces: Protect leather and synthetic materials from water and humidity.
  • Store Properly: Use heel supports or boxes to maintain shape.
  • Rotate Your Pair: Prevent excessive wear and fading to keep heels looking fresh.
